Great Reasons To Install A Pond In Your Garden

If you are looking for different ways to bring life back to a dull home this year, the garden is a feature you may not have considered decorating


Your garden is an important feature of the house and it plays a huge role in your home, especially during the summer months. Today we want to take a look at the garden and consider building a pond to elevate the space. 


But why a pond? 

Well, we are about to tell you exactly why.

Attract wildlife 

The first reason you should cosndier installing a pond in your garden is that it will attract animals of all kinds. Once you fit your pond with some plants and a pump such as the Tsurumi LB-800, you’ll be able to bring animals such as fish or frogs into your space. Having animals such as frogs and fish in your pond will be brilliant for your garden, and you’ll likely attract a lot of other animals such as mammals who will drink from the pond, and birds who will visit your pond. Having wildlife thriving in your garden is a great thing and is something you should strive for. 


Add a stunning feature 

If you have ever seen a garden pond in all its glory, you will know that it can make a stunning water feature for any outdoor space. In the same way a fireplace brings a focal point to the living room, a pond will bring a focal point to your garden and will make people stop and pay attention. You can play around with the design of your pond so it can be as simple as a hole in the ground with a row of paving around it; or could be as stunning as a pond built from the ground with slate and including steps to walk around it. You can really get creative with building a pond in your garden and it is a brilliant way to bring something extra to your garden. 


Show off pond plants 

There are so many stunning plants you can bring into your pond such as pond lilies, water lettuce and blue iris as well as a host more. If you are always looking for an excuse to show off more plant life in your garden this is a great opportunity for that.


Create an ecosystem 

One of the brilliant reasons to build a pond for your garden is to create an ecosystem. Our planet is in dire need of help, and the animals that live in our ecosystems have less and less space to thrive as green spaces are torn down. By building a pond in your garden you will provide a living space for many forms of life and this will make a massive difference to the health of many species in your local area. It’s a small gesture but can actually be a huge deal if you are an animal lover!
